The rise and fall of this network, first launched in 2005 as PBS Kids Sprout, originally in partnership with PBS, Sesame Workshop, HIT Entertainment and Comcast. Comcast’s buyout of NBCUniversal led to its now-owned subsidiary to own its stake, and eventually they would buy out the other companies’ stakes, with NBCUniversal/Comcast getting full ownership. Then in 2017 they rebranded to Universal Kids and recently shut down in early 2025.
